Impellergröße
Impellergröße refers to the physical dimensions of an impeller, a rotating component with vanes or blades used to impart motion to a fluid. This size is a critical factor in determining the performance characteristics of pumps, turbines, and other fluid machinery. Key dimensions typically include the impeller diameter, width, and the geometry of the vanes themselves, such as their angle and profile.
